Transaction 939b531367c1cddd6d740ef4554a543e4d396454e4a11fff5df4aec2624f148f

block
14504445a17042c2bb423b36f9b20dcc7a35d2ec968f59aacdc25d2759671e26

10 Inputs

2 Outputs